    Mostly great, some things not so great

    |
    |
    Posted .
    This reviewer received promo considerations or sweepstakes entry for writing a review.

    You've probably read that if you're a fan (or familiar) with Piranha Bytes other games, you know what you're in for. I've played a couple, but this is by far the best with the most immersive, interesting and thought out world. The gameplay, story and ideas within are so good that you'll be compelled to push forward, but it's hard at first. Like really hard. One hit and you're dead hard. But leveling up is super fun and soon enough you'll be cracking skulls. The difficulty forces you to strategize about how you'll take on the next quest, which is nice. What's not so great is the draw distance -- up close is beautiful, looking off in the "foggy" distance, not so much. And, again, the one-shot kills can be VERY frustrating. Overall, I really liked my time with Elex and you will, too...if you understand that it's a challenge, but ultimately worth it.

    Euro-jank-PG

    |
    |
    Posted .
    This reviewer received promo considerations or sweepstakes entry for writing a review.

    You know them, you love them, you want to play them and throw them out the window at the same time. Welcome to an European RPG. The game is full of bugs, janky combat, weird glitches, and more. But for some reason it is charming as hail with a very open ended quest, tons of places to explore that feels real and not cut off from the game by a loading screen (Fallout). Fill yourself with patience and dive in into the crazy world of Euro-jank-PG Get it. Cheers
